DAVID CURTIS, THE 155,000 STEP PROGRAMME
Épisode 9
mardi 3 décembre 2024 • Durée 41:37
On this episode of The Diary of an Average Joe, Christian Couzens interviews David Curtis, who shares his powerful story of recovery and resilience. After battling addiction and grief, David found solace in running and is now training for ultra marathons. In this candid conversation, David reflects on his experiences growing up in the rave scene, the impact of his sister’s death, and how running helped him channel his energy into something positive. This is a story of hope, perseverance, and the power of running. Don’t miss it

RAYA USHER, LIFE AFTER THE CANNONBALL CRASH
Épisode 7
mercredi 6 novembre 2024 • Durée 42:12
On this episode of Diary of an Average Joe, Christian Couzens interviews Raya Usher, also known as the Canadian Cannonball, whose promising Olympic ski career was cut short by a life-altering accident. Raya’s resilience and determination shine as she recounts her recovery, transition into triathlon, and the pursuit of her passion for finance. She shares the lessons learned along the way, emphasising the importance of taking control of life and pursuing one’s passions. A powerful story of personal growth and perseverance you won’t want to miss.
BEN DRAGON, ADAPTING TO LIFE WITH SIGHT LOSS
Saison 1 · Épisode 2
mardi 22 octobre 2024 • Durée 39:41
On this episode of Diary of an Average Joe, Christian Couzens speaks with Ben Dragon, who opens up about his journey of adapting to life with severe sight impairment caused by Pseudoxanthoma Elasticum. Ben shares the challenges he has faced since his diagnosis, how he uses a symbol cane to alert others to his condition, and the importance of resilience and family support. His story is one of hope and perseverance, offering insight into the emotional impact of sight loss and the power of adaptability.
Don’t miss this inspiring episode.

MARK PAVLIKA, LOST IN ADDICTION, FOUND IN MINDFULNESS
Saison 1 · Épisode 1
mardi 8 octobre 2024 • Durée 51:47
This week on Diary of an Average Joe, Christian Couzens speaks with Mark Pavlika, who shares his transformative journey from a life marked by addiction and rejection to finding peace and mindfulness. Mark’s candid discussion touches on his struggles with identity, growing up in a Jehovah’s Witness family, and how small steps towards change can lead to incredible personal transformation. He highlights the power of mindfulness and the value of living authentically. Don’t miss this inspiring episode.
